US media say former President Donald Trump is considering announcing his candidacy for the 2024 presidential election on November 14.
Media outlets, including Axios, reported on Friday that a series of multi-day political events will possibly follow the official announcement.
The latest polls suggest that Republicans will likely make gains in Congress in next Tuesday's midterm elections.
Axios says Trump hopes to take credit for possible Republican victories to build momentum for his presidential bid.
Observers say the level of success by candidates Trump supports will determine how much he will be able to maintain his influence.
A special committee of the House of Representatives is looking into the attack on the Capitol by Trump's supporters in January last year. The FBI is also continuing its investigation after seizing classified documents from his home.
